Please click here to check who's online and chat with them.

Cape Town Canned Fish Suppliers and Manufacturers

VERIFIED
Sep-16-16
Supplier From Cape Town, Western Province, South Africa
1 Canned Fish Suppliers
Short on time? Let Canned Fish sellers contact you.